码迷,mamicode.com
首页 > 数据库 > 详细

MySQL架构

时间:2019-08-09 15:18:14      阅读:91      评论:0      收藏:0      [点我收藏+]

标签:客户端连接   scn   详细   缓存   innodb   存储   这一   文章   memory   

MySQL架构

1. 逻辑架构

1.1 逻辑架构图

技术图片

1.2 架构分层

1.2.1 连接层

MySQL 客户端连接到MySQL server都是经过这一层的, 用与处理连接,授权校验,安全.

1.2.2 服务层

服务层是MySQL的核心服务层:

  1. 查询分析
  2. SQL优化
  3. 缓存机制
  4. 内建函数
  5. 触发器
  6. 视图
  7. 存储过程
  8. .....等等

1.2.3 存储层

存储层就是 MySQL用于存放数据的处理程序--存储引擎

MySQL内置的存储引擎有:

  • InnoDB
  • MyISAM
  • Memory
  • NDB
  • Archive

MySQL5.7的默认存储引擎是InnoDB,至于关于各个存储引擎的详细会在之后的系列文章讲到

MySQL架构

标签:客户端连接   scn   详细   缓存   innodb   存储   这一   文章   memory   

原文地址:https://www.cnblogs.com/suveng/p/11327194.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!